Independent restaurant operators face unique challenges in the foodservice industry. Limited resources and a shortage of manpower often make it difficult to compete with larger chains. In the face of these challenges, one powerful ally emerges: restaurant technology.

Redefining how you run your business, technology can breathe new life into the health of your restaurant.

Here are four compelling reasons why you should embrace restaurant technology to enhance your operations and boost profitability:

visibility into purchasing

Visibility into Purchasing

In the restaurant business, every dollar counts, and effective cost management is paramount. Restaurant technology provides you with invaluable insights into your purchasing habits and supplier relationships. By leveraging data-driven decision-making, you can make informed choices that save money and enhance product quality.

Imagine having the ability to analyze your purchasing patterns, supplier performance, and product costs in real-time. With technology, you can. This level of visibility empowers you to:

  • Discover New Savings Opportunities: Uncover hidden cost-saving opportunities by identifying trends, negotiating better deals with suppliers, and optimizing your purchasing strategy.
  • Enhance Product Quality: Ensure that you consistently source high-quality ingredients by monitoring supplier performance and product freshness.
  • Streamline Ordering: Automate your ordering process based on historical data and current demand, eliminating human error and reducing waste.

This practical approach to purchasing isn’t just about saving money; it’s about achieving better results for your restaurant. No fluff, just results.

Restaurant Technology for Inventory Management

Inventory Management

Effective inventory management is essential for cost control and waste reduction. With restaurant technology, you can take your inventory management to the next level by tracking inventory in real-time. This means no more guessing games, no more overstocking, and no more running out of essential ingredients.

Here’s how technology transforms your inventory management:

  • Minimize Overstocking: Prevent over-purchasing by having a clear view of your inventory levels. Set up automatic reorder points to ensure you never run out of crucial items or overstock perishable goods.
  • Optimize Orders: Make informed decisions about when and how much to order, reducing waste and controlling costs.
  • Reduce Waste: Accurate tracking helps you identify and address potential issues, such as ingredient spoilage or theft, promptly.

This practical approach eliminates spoiled ingredients and costly stockouts, putting more money back in your pocket.

Cost-Effective Products

Find Cost-Effective Products

In a cost-sensitive industry, every penny saved matters. Technology becomes your ally in identifying budget-friendly ingredients and products without compromising on quality. Through data analytics, you can conduct precise cost analyses and discover the best suppliers and deals.

Here’s how technology helps you find cost-effective products:

  • Data-Driven Decisions: Use data analytics to evaluate the cost-effectiveness of different ingredients and products, enabling you to make informed choices.
  • Supplier Assessment: Continuously assess your suppliers’ pricing and performance to ensure you’re getting the best value for your money.
  • Enhance Menu Quality: By optimizing your ingredient costs, you can reinvest in improving the quality and uniqueness of your menu offerings, attracting more customers.

This pragmatic approach reduces expenses while elevating the overall dining experience for your customers.

Back Office Automation

Restuarant Back Office Automation

Managing back-office tasks like payroll, accounting, accounts payable, and food cost management can be overwhelming for independent restaurant owners. Fortunately, software solutions can automate these processes, freeing up your time to focus on more enjoyable tasks and enhancing efficiency.

Here’s how technology streamlines your back-office operations:

  • Payroll Management: Automate payroll calculations, tax filings, and employee scheduling, reducing administrative overhead and ensuring accurate payments.
  • Accounting: Simplify your accounting processes, from tracking expenses and revenue to generating financial reports and forecasting future performance.
  • Accounts Payable: Streamline invoice processing and payment workflows, reducing the risk of late payments and improving supplier relationships.
  • Food Cost Management: Easily track and manage food costs, analyze menu profitability, and make data-driven decisions to optimize your offerings.

This practical approach to back-office automation allows you to run a tighter ship and boost overall efficiency—practical efficiency.
